Traveling from Elizabethtown-Kitley to Barrie involves a 420-kilometer journey heading west and then north. You will primarily use Highway 401 to reach the Greater Toronto Area before transitioning to Highway 400 North. The drive typically takes 4.5 to 5 hours depending on traffic flow. Barrie serves as the gateway to Ontario's cottage country, located on the shores of Kempenfelt Bay. This route is popular for those heading toward Muskoka.
Total Distance: 420 km driving distance, 350 km straight-line air distance.
Expect heavy traffic on Highway 400 on Friday afternoons.
